About This Program

The Mechatronics, Robotics, and Automation Engineering Technology/Technician program at Craven Community College in New Bern, NC is a two- to four-year certificate in the engineering technology field (CIP 15.0407). This public institution trains students in the integration of mechanical, electrical, and computer control systems found in automated manufacturing and robotics applications.

Students can build on or complement this program with related offerings at Craven, including Electromechanical Technologies/Technicians, CAD/CADD Drafting and/or Design Technology/Technician, and Automobile/Automotive Mechanics Technology/Technician. The college's technical program offerings reflect a focus on preparing students for advanced manufacturing and industrial careers in the New Bern area and beyond.
